Sulphur Springs Independent School District (SSISD) is a public K-12 school district serving the community of Sulphur Springs, Texas. With an estimated 501-1000 employees, the district manages multiple campuses, providing educational services, transportation, nutrition, and extracurricular activities. Its core mission is to deliver quality education and prepare students for future success within the framework of public funding and state standards.

For a mid-sized public school district, AI presents a transformative lever to address perennial challenges: optimizing constrained budgets, personalizing education at scale, and reducing the administrative burden that diverts resources from teaching. At this size, districts have enough data and operational complexity to benefit significantly from automation and analytics but often lack the vast IT resources of larger metropolitan districts. Strategic AI adoption can help level the playing field, enabling more efficient resource use and tailored student support.

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ing

1. Personalized Learning Pathways: Deploying AI-driven adaptive learning software in core subjects like math and English can provide real-time, individualized practice and remediation. The ROI is measured in improved standardized test scores, reduced need for expensive remedial tutoring programs, and increased student engagement. By addressing learning gaps early, the district can improve graduation rates and long-term student outcomes.

2. Administrative Process Automation: Implementing AI for routine tasks—such as processing forms, scheduling, and responding to frequent parent inquiries—can free up hundreds of staff hours annually. The direct ROI is labor cost avoidance or the reallocation of skilled staff to higher-value tasks like student counseling and family engagement. It also improves community satisfaction through faster response times.

Predictive Student Support Systems: Using machine learning on anonymized datasets (attendance, grades, behavior incidents) to identify students at risk of chronic absenteeism or academic failure allows for proactive intervention. The ROI is multifaceted: reducing dropout rates improves state funding (tied to attendance), lowers long-term social costs, and fulfills the district's ethical mission. Early intervention is far more cost-effective than remediation.

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band

Districts of this scale face unique implementation risks. Budgetary Constraints mean AI projects must compete with essential needs like teacher salaries and facility maintenance, requiring clear, short-term ROI demonstrations. Data Privacy and Security are paramount under FERPA; any solution must have robust compliance guarantees, and the district may lack dedicated legal/cybersecurity expertise to vet vendors thoroughly. Change Management across multiple campuses and a diverse staff with varying tech proficiency can slow adoption. There's also a risk of exacerbating equity gaps if AI tool access is inconsistent across schools or student groups. Success depends on phased pilots, strong vendor partnerships, and continuous staff training to build trust and competence in using new AI-enhanced systems.
